#B1C130 Hex color

#B1C130

The hexadecimal color code #B1C130 corresponds to the code RGB( 177, 193, 48 ). It's a shade of Yellow. This color is a combination of red (at 0,69 level), green (at 0,76 level) and blue (at 0,19 level). Its brightness is 47% and its saturation is 60%. It is composed of red at 42%, green at 46% and blue at 11%.
